In a village where water is scarce and the land is unforgiving, Sundaram Verma found a way to grow trees using only one litre of water per plant. His simple method has helped over 60,000 trees survive drought — and inspired farmers across India to rethink how change takes root.
Gaurav Pachauri took up freshwater pearl farming after failing to crack government exams for four years. He set up a pearl farm in Bharatpur, Rajasthan, earning Rs 55 lakh within 21 months.
